Check the filters within your furnace, regularly. They can become clogged if these filters have not been cleaned or replaced recently. This may affect how good your furnace will be able to work, meaning that you may not have enough heat throughout the winter. Take this straightforward step, the moment the weather actually starts to become cold.

Next time you have a clogged drain, prevent the simple solution of dumping drain-clearing chemicals to the pipes. Although this method necessitates the least amount of effort, the harmful chemicals during these liquid cleaners are destructive to the piping. Instead, consider utilizing a small amount of hard work by using a plunger, snake, or any other device designed to clear your clog without chemicals.

Use strainers in every drains to trap hair along with other objects. This may prevent every one of the material from going down the sink and creating a clog, that may result in a bigger problem down the line. Clean out the strainers daily so that you will don't start to get backup of water with your sink or tub.

Once a year take away the faucet aerator and clean the screens a minimum of. This can help it properly function. The function of a faucet aerator is usually to allow for a much flow water and to conserve water. Make sure you clean out of the aerator and you'll notice a this stuff working.

Check how good your toilets are flushing. In the event the handle must be played with to keep the water from running constantly, or maybe if it needs to be held down repeatedly to be able to flush, you may need to switch out several of the parts in your tank. This is simply not expensive, and yes it might help lower your monthly water bill. It may also mean that you avoid the embarrassment of the flushing system breaking when you have visitors!

Everyone in your home should know in which the main water turn off valve is. By knowing how to locate this valve, you'll be able to turn off water in the event a pipe bursts, a bathtub or toilet overflows or another emergency that needs one to shut down the liquid.

Watch out for decreased quantities of intensity within the water flow inside your bathroom. This can be a symbol of calcium or mineral deposits disrupting water flow. If spotted early enough it might be easy to remedy this while not having to replace the pipes.

If the water pressure on your own street exceeds 60 pounds, you many be considering installing a pressure reducing valve. Too much water pressure is in fact harmful to your plumbing system and may cause excess water pressure. A pressure reducing valve decreases your water pressure by almost one half.

A water heater that has no tank click here is a great choice for those that are conservation-minded. They don't store water, and also heat water only upon an when needed basis. This saves money by not heating water pointlessly.

To avoid hair from clogging your drains, install strainers in each tub and shower to capture the hairs before they may go down the drain. When combined with soap build-up, hair will bring your drains into a complete standstill, so it's vital that you stop the hairs from reaching the pipes from the beginning.

Run dishwashers and washing machines through the night, or during periods when people are certainly not using so much water. This can keep water pressure strong for showers and other things, while ensuring dishwashing and laundry still takes place on time. In addition, it preserves energy use and costs.

When leaving on holiday or leaving your vacation home, make sure you turn off the main water before you leave. If something happens while you are gone you can cause some serious damage coming from a flooded basement or a broken pipe in the wall that leaks for weeks up until you return.

Do not pour oil and grease down your drains. Cooking grease will increase with your pipes and might cause back-ups. Keep oil and grease in a container with your fridge and throw it inside the trash when it is full. Avoid clogging your pipes with any products containing oil or grease.

Will not unclog your drains having a chemical drain cleaner. Whilst they could be successful in unclogging the drain, the dangerous chemicals within these products can be damaging in your skin. If you must start using these harsh chemicals, always protect yourself with long-sleeved shirts and gloves.

While you are snaking from the drain, always make sure that you employ a mask to pay for your face. You will end up pulling up a number of chemicals that you just do not want to inhale or get on your skin. If you want to optimize your wellbeing, practice safe plumbing.

Annually, you should check your toilet tanks for leaks by pouring red food coloring in the tank. Leave it inside on an hour and look the toilet bowl water. If the water turns red, this means it is likely you have a leak and you need to have it fixed soon.
